Sound Absorption Efficiency
Choosing the right acoustic panels for your music room hinges on understanding their sound absorption efficiency. Look for panels with a Noise Reduction Coefficient (NRC) rating above 0.9, as these indicate superior sound absorption. Panels designed to absorb a wide frequency range, from 150 to 20,000 Hz, will help minimize reverberation and flutter echoes, enhancing your sound quality. Thicker panels, typically 2 inches or more, offer better absorption due to their increased density. Additionally, consider the material composition; high-density polyester or polyurethane foam is effective at reducing unwanted noise. Ensuring a secure installation can also influence performance, so choose options like self-adhesive backing or construction adhesive for ideal results.
Installation Method Ease
Understanding sound absorption efficiency is only part of the equation; the installation method can greatly impact your acoustic panels’ performance. Look for panels with self-adhesive backing for quick and easy installation—this means no extra tools or adhesives required. Evaluate options that allow for flexible mounting, like picture hangers or construction adhesive, so you can adapt to different wall surfaces and layouts. Lightweight panels make handling and mounting simpler, especially in high or hard-to-reach spots. Also, check if the panels come vacuum-packed or need expansion time after unpacking, as this can affect your installation timeline. Finally, assess user feedback on adhesive quality; some panels may leave residue or damage walls when removed, which is vital to take into account.
Material Quality Importance
Material quality plays a pivotal role in the effectiveness of acoustic panels in your music room. Opt for high-density foam or polyester fabric, as these materials greatly enhance sound absorption; some panels boast Noise Reduction Coefficient (NRC) ratings up to 0.95. Choosing eco-friendly and non-toxic options is essential for safety in indoor spaces. Durability matters too—look for flame-retardant panels resistant to aging, ensuring they maintain acoustic performance over time. Additionally, specific designs like wedge or pyramid shapes maximize surface area for better sound diffusion and absorption. Remember, thickness matters; panels that are 2 inches or more generally provide superior sound absorption across a wider range of frequencies, giving you the best acoustic experience possible.

Size and Coverage
Choosing the right size and coverage for your acoustic panels is essential in enhancing your music room’s sound quality. Larger panels, like those measuring 72 x 48 inches, offer greater coverage and improved sound absorption compared to smaller options. Additionally, consider thickness; panels that are 2 inches thick absorb lower frequencies better, enhancing overall sound quality. When determining coverage, aim to cover about 20-30% of your wall surfaces to effectively reduce echoes and reverberation. For flexibility, a 24-pack of 12 x 12 inch panels can be strategically placed throughout the room. Finally, arrange the panels at varying heights and locations to optimize sound control and minimize reflections for the best acoustic experience.
